Abstract

498,703. Electron multipliers. GENERAL ELECTRIC CO., Ltd., and McLEOD, A. E. Oct. 9, 1937, No. 27498. [Class 39 (i)] In a multiplier of the type in which the electron stream is guided from one cathode to the next by the electrostatic fielc of positive "potentia plates" in conjunctior with a perpendicular mag netic field, the potential plate 2 positive to the nth cathode forms a mechanically integral member with the (n+1)th cathode 1, the members being so shaped that they can be assembled in a pile separated by thin insulators such as mica sheets, and held together by insulating supports other than the separating insulation, for example glass rods passing through the holes 8, 9. The primary cathode may be photo-electric, or thermionic with a control grid supported between mica end spacers. The last member before the collecting electrode has only a depending plate 2 and a gauze screen covering the aperture 5. Small tubular resistors are connected to each electrode within the envelope. The portions 7 may act as cooling fins for the cathode. Specification 478,262 is referred to.
